The Limitations of Survey-First Market Research

Traditional survey-driven research models struggle to keep up with modern business needs. They were designed for periodic studies, not continuous decision-making.

Common limitations include:

  • One-time data snapshots instead of continuous insight
  • Disconnected tools for surveys, panels, incentives, and reporting
  • Heavy manual effort across research operations
  • Delayed insights that arrive after decisions are already made
  • Limited integration with business systems

As markets move faster, insights generated weeks later often lose relevance. Businesses now need systems that can collect feedback, validate data, analyze trends, and deliver insights continuously.

The Shift: Market Research as a System, Not a Study

Modern organizations now view market research as an always-on capability rather than a series of isolated studies. This means research is becoming a connected system that supports ongoing business decisions.

This shift includes:

  • Continuous data collection instead of one-off surveys
  • Centralized platforms instead of fragmented tools
  • Real-time dashboards instead of static reports
  • Automated workflows instead of manual operations
  • Integrated insights instead of disconnected research outputs

What Does It Mean for Market Research to Become a Software Product?

When market research becomes a software product, it is designed with product thinking, not just project execution. The focus shifts from running individual studies to operating a long-term insight engine.

Such systems typically include:

  • Modular survey and workflow engines
  • Integrated panel and respondent management
  • Incentive and reward automation
  • Real-time analytics and visualization
  • AI-driven quality checks and insights
  • Role-based access and reporting
  • API-based integrations with internal systems

Instead of launching surveys manually every time, teams can manage research through a structured platform. This helps businesses collect insights faster, reduce operational effort, and make better use of first-party data.

Why This Transition Is Happening Now

Several forces are driving this transformation. Businesses need faster insights, stronger data ownership, and more automated research operations.

1. Speed of Decision-Making

Businesses can no longer afford delayed insights. Software-driven research systems deliver data in real time, enabling faster responses to market changes.

When teams can access live dashboards and automated reports, they do not have to wait weeks for manual analysis. This makes research more useful for product, marketing, customer experience, and leadership teams.

2. Growth of First-Party Data

Organizations want direct ownership of customer and audience data. This requires custom platforms rather than complete dependence on third-party tools.

First-party data helps companies build long-term insight assets. It also improves control over audience segmentation, respondent history, study performance, and compliance.

3. AI and Automation Maturity

AI now supports data validation, pattern recognition, respondent quality checks, and predictive insights. These capabilities work best when they are connected to an integrated research system.

4. Rising Research Complexity

Modern research spans regions, languages, channels, audience groups, and data sources. Managing this complexity requires software, not spreadsheets.

As research operations grow, manual workflows become slow and error-prone. A software-first approach helps teams manage complexity with better structure, automation, and visibility.

How Software-Driven Market Research Changes Business Value

Software-driven market research changes how organizations create and use insights. It moves research from a support function to a strategic business capability.

From Reports to Dashboards

Instead of static PDFs, stakeholders access live dashboards tailored to their roles and KPIs. Product teams, marketing leaders, client teams, and executives can view the insights that matter most to them.

This reduces dependency on manual reporting. It also helps decision-makers act faster.

From Fieldwork to Automation

Survey launches, panel engagement, reward distribution, respondent validation, and reporting can run automatically. This reduces repetitive work for research teams.

Automation also improves consistency. Teams can standardize workflows while still customizing studies based on audience, region, or project type.

From Data Collection to Intelligence

Insights evolve from descriptive reporting to predictive intelligence. Instead of only showing what happened, software-driven systems can help identify what may happen next.

This creates stronger value for businesses. Research becomes a continuous source of intelligence, not just a one-time report.

From Cost Center to Strategic Asset

Market research platforms become long-term investments that compound in value over time. Every study, respondent interaction, and data point can strengthen the overall insight system.

Custom Software vs Tool-Based Research Platforms

Off-the-shelf research tools are built for generic use cases. Software-driven research systems are built around the business.

Key differences include:

Factor Tool-Based Research Platforms Custom Survey SaaS Platform
Workflows Rigid templates Custom workflows
Data control Platform-controlled data Owned research and respondent data
Integrations Limited connectors Deep integrations with business systems
Scalability Based on licenses and vendor limits Built around business growth
Dashboards Generic reporting KPI-specific dashboards
Automation Limited or predefined Custom automation logic
AI usage Tool-dependent Business-specific AI workflows
